Snow Drift Springs Shrine Location in Ghost of Yotei
You’ll find the Snow Drift Springs Shrine in the southwestern area of Teshio Ridge, just west of Red Crane Inn and near the region’s hot springs. The area is dotted with fox statues and lantern posts — key components of the puzzle. When you arrive, you’ll notice a sealed door ahead and several groups of stone foxes nearby. These statues hold the secret to unlocking the entrance.
How the Puzzle Works in Ghost of Yotei
The shrine’s riddle centers around three sets of fox statue altars, each with a unique pattern. Each set has three lantern posts topped with different fox poses — sitting, crouching, or howling. Behind each group, you’ll spot a single fox statue that hints at which altar should be lit.
To solve the puzzle, your task is simple but requires keen observation: Light the lantern that matches the fox statue’s pose behind the altar set.
A nearby brazier provides the torch you’ll need to ignite them.
How to Solve the Snow Drift Springs Shrine Puzzle – Full Walkthrough
First Set (Left of the Door)
Start from the shrine’s entrance and move left toward a small pond. Pick up a torch from the brazier beside the path. Look toward the water — you’ll see a fox statue sitting upright with its head slightly tilted. Match this pose with the leftmost lantern in the group and light it.
This completes the first step.
Second Set (Right of the Door)
Next, move to the right side of the entrance where a large boulder sits behind another trio of fox lanterns. Here, the background statue shows a fox with its head raised in a howl. Light the rightmost lantern in this group to mirror that pose.
Third Set (On the Ridge)
Turn around from the main path and climb the short ridge behind the shrine. Up here, another set of three lanterns awaits near a shallow pond. The fox statue behind this group crouches low to the ground — the same pose as the middle lantern. Light the center lantern to complete the final step of the exterior puzzle.
When done correctly, you’ll hear the door mechanism shift, and the entrance to the shrine will open slightly, allowing you to crawl underneath to access the hidden area.
Inside the Shrine: The Hidden Hideout
Beyond the newly opened passage lies a short tunnel that leads into the Snow Drift Springs Hideout, one of the Yotei Six Camps hidden throughout Teshio Ridge. The hideout is packed with Nine-Tails members, so be prepared for combat.
You can take advantage of tall grass for stealth takedowns or climb high perches to pick off enemies silently. Whether you prefer silent assassinations or open confrontation, the camp’s compact layout makes it manageable either way.
The Second Fox Puzzle Inside
After clearing the enemies and freeing the prisoner, look toward the upper level of the hideout — you’ll encounter another fox-lantern puzzle. This one is shorter and simpler.
You’ll see two pairs of fox statues behind the lanterns. Light the leftmost lanterns on both sides, matching the background foxes’ stances. Doing so opens a new pathway upward, leading to the Altar of Reflection and the Kitsune Puzzle, where you can claim your next reward and collectible progress.
What Happens After Solving the Snow Drift Springs Shrine Puzzle
Solving the Snow Drift Springs Shrine puzzle not only grants entry to a hidden camp but also unlocks one of the key Nine-Tails Puzzle Boxes in Ghost of Yotei. These boxes count toward the Trickster Fox Trophy, an important collectible milestone for completionists.
If you’re aiming for 100% completion in Teshio Ridge, make sure to finish this puzzle as it connects directly to the wider Kitsune network of hidden shrines and secret rewards.
Quick Recap: Snow Drift Springs Shrine Puzzle Solution
Puzzle Area | Fox Pose | Lantern to Light |
---|---|---|
Left side of door | Sitting upright | Leftmost |
Right side of door | Howling | Rightmost |
Ridge behind shrine | Crouched | Middle |
Inside hideout (upper level) | Facing forward foxes | Leftmost on both sides |

Quick Tips for Snow Drift Springs Shrine Puzzle Ghost of Yotei
- Always grab a torch from the nearby brazier before attempting each section.
- Each puzzle’s solution mirrors the fox statue behind the lanterns — if you’re unsure, step back and observe.
- Once inside, clearing the camp and completing the second fox puzzle leads you to the Altar of Reflection for further rewards.
- Nothing here is missable — you can revisit and complete the shrine later during free roam.
